Neuropsychological Testing

NCCF has obtained the services of Dr. Lewis M. Etcoff, who is the only board certified neuropsychologist in Nevada, to identify cognitive and affective deficits caused by disease and/or treatment. Dr. Etcoff’s specialized testing is concerned with learning and behavior and their association with your child’s brain structure and systems.

The data collected is used to target specific brain dysfunction and build appropriate accommodations and modifications to the curriculum and school environment that meet your child’s needs and heighten their adaptability and success. Often, the results are shared with school personnel and used to initiate or add accommodations and goals through either a 504 plan or IEP. The results offer parents and teachers valuable insight into the child’s educational needs and how these needs may best be met by school staff. Additionally, testing provides a better understanding of your child’s behavior and learning at home and in the community.
